什么是冷钱包源码?如何安全地管理你的数字资
引言
在数字货币和区块链技术日益普及的今天,安全性已成为投资者最关心的问题之一。冷钱包作为一种安全的数字资产存储方案,受到了越来越多人的关注。而冷钱包源码的了解,能够帮助用户更好地管理自己的数字资产。本文将对冷钱包源码进行全面的探讨,涵盖其定义、工作原理、以及如何安全管理数字资产的方法。
冷钱包是什么?
冷钱包,顾名思义,是指不与互联网直接连接的加密货币钱包。与热钱包(通常在线存储)相对,冷钱包因其离线的特性,更加安全。冷钱包主要分为硬件钱包和纸钱包。硬件钱包是一种专用设备,例如Ledger和Trezor等,它们通过USB或蓝牙连接到计算机。而纸钱包则是将私钥和公钥打印在纸上,完全离线。
冷钱包源码的意义
冷钱包源码指的是用于构建冷钱包应用程序的代码。了解冷钱包的源码,有助于与社区分享安全性,审视潜在的漏洞,以及更好地理解底层机制。开发者可以根据源码修改或定制冷钱包的功能,从而创建更加符合自身需求的产品。同时,开源的特性也能促使更多的开发者参与到社区中。
如何制作自己的冷钱包?
创建冷钱包的过程并不复杂,但需要一定的技术基础。首先,你需要选择一个开源的冷钱包项目作为起点,Github是一个很好的资源平台。下载项目源码后,能够通过学习代码了解钱包的工作原理,之后就可以根据自己的需求进行修改。安装必要的依赖包,然后配置好环境,再进行编译和测试,在这个过程中,要确保遵循良好的编码 practices,以避免潜在的安全隐患。
如何安全地管理你的数字资产?
冷钱包提供了较高的安全性,但如果不妥善管理,也可能导致资产丢失。第一步是确保你的冷钱包私钥和助记词的安全存储,可以使用密码保护的电子文件,或纸质记录。此外,应定期备份冷钱包,并保持不同地点的备份,以防自然灾害等不可抗力因素导致的资料丢失。其次,务必谨慎对待任何要求输入私钥或助记词的请求,始终保持警惕,以防被钓鱼攻击。
相关问题
- 冷钱包的与热钱包的区别是什么?
- 冷钱包的安全性如何保障?
- 如何选择合适的冷钱包类型?
- 冷钱包中的私钥和公钥有什么作用?
- 如何实现冷钱包的数据备份与恢复?
- 未来冷钱包的发展趋势是什么?
1. 冷钱包的与热钱包的区别是什么?
热钱包是指与互联网连接并且可以随时进行交易的钱包,例如交易所的钱包和手机应用钱包。虽然它们的使用便捷性较高,但在安全性上较弱,容易受到黑客攻击。而冷钱包则因其离线存储的特性,不容易受到外部攻击,为用户提供了更高的安全保障。总之,热钱包适合频繁交易的用户,而冷钱包则是为长期投资提供了一个相对安全的存储方案。
2. 冷钱包的安全性如何保障?
保障冷钱包安全的方式主要有以下几种:第一,确保设备的物理安全,定期检查硬件是否完好;第二,使用高强度的密码保护私钥和助记词;第三,定期更新冷钱包的固件,以修复已知漏洞;最后,避免将敏感信息存储在联网设备上。采取以上措施能够最大程度降低资产被盗的风险。
3. 如何选择合适的冷钱包类型?
选择冷钱包时,需要考虑多个因素,包括用户的需求、技术水平和资金的规模。对于新手用户,可以选择那些易于使用的硬件钱包,例如Ledger Nano S或Trezor,这些设备通常附带友好的用户界面和详细的说明。而对于有一定开发经验的用户,可以考虑自己构建冷钱包或使用功能更加复杂的设备。
4. 冷钱包中的私钥和公钥有什么作用?
私钥是用来进行数字资产交易的重要凭证,失去私钥则丧失对资产的控制权。公钥则是用来接收资金的地址。可以将公钥视为银行账户,对外公开,而私钥则是你在线银行的密码,绝不能泄露给他人。无论是冷钱包还是热钱包,妥善管理私钥和公钥都至关重要。
5. 如何实现冷钱包的数据备份与恢复?
在创建冷钱包的过程中,需要生成助记词或私钥,用户需要将其安全存储。可以采用多重备份方案,比如将助记词书写在纸上,放置在防火的保险箱内。此外,还可以利用加密技术加密备份数据,并存储在多个地方,以确保在任何情况下都能恢复资产。
6. 未来冷钱包的发展趋势是什么?
随着区块链技术的不断发展,以及数字资产的日益增多,冷钱包的重要性将愈加凸显。未来,冷钱包可能会进一步整合生物识别技术、智能合约等先进技术,以提升安全性和用户体验。同时,冷钱包的可扩展性和多资产支持能力也将成为用户选择的重要指标。随着用户对安全性要求的提高,冷钱包市场也将迎来更大的发展机遇。
结论
冷钱包作为保护数字资产的有效工具,其源码也为用户提供了更多的自主权和选择可能性。本文不仅介绍了冷钱包的基础知识及其源码的重要性,还深入探讨了一些用户最关心的问题与发展趋势。希望能够帮助用户在数字货币领域中更加安全地管理自己的资产。